CVE-2026-58175 is a high-severity memory management vulnerability in Apache Traffic Server caused by improper release of memory while handling HostDB SRV records in HostDB processing. The flaw affects Apache Traffic Server versions 8.0.0 through 8.1.9, 9.0.0 through 9.2.14, and 10.0.0 through 10.1.3. Repeated processing of affected SRV record handling paths can cause memory to accumulate instead of being freed after its effective lifetime, resulting in progressive resource exhaustion. Published classifications map the issue to CWE-401.
